Peter, obviously, with HP, the forward GC is more felt in the aft cyclic in hover..

I've trained in both, over 200 hours R22 now, incl bunch of solo flying. HP is very nice for lateral CG flying solo, as well, obviously left skid toe bit low two up, as I fly it with instructor.

HP has more power than Beta. It's not just the weight of fuel that reduces Beta II's performance. Also picking up BII solo on full tanks is bit tricky, like backwards slope, with the extra mass aft of mast.

As mentioned, no aux tank means easier view of flex plate and push-pull rods and their ends.

bungee 'sissy trim' is good for long XC trips, reduces wrist fatigue, instead of pulling the cyclic to right in cruise, one has to apply slight pressure to the left instead, resting hand/wrist against the leg/knee.
